Example

Convert 1 kJ/kg.K to ft.lb/lb.F.

  • Step 1: Write the formula: ft.lb/lb.F = kJ/kg.K × 185.862551
  • Step 2: Substitute: 1 × 185.862551
  • Step 3: Result: 185.862551 ft.lb/lb.F
So, 1 kJ/kg.K = 185.862551 ft.lb/lb.F.
